It is a hotel-museum. First opened in 1895 to welcome visitors from the Orient Express, it has been a witness to some of the greatest figures in modern history, lasting through the reigns of three Ottoman sultans, the fall of the Ottoman Empire, and the rise of the New Turkish Republic - and also contains some incredible mysteries, including one about Agatha Christie, who wrote Murder on the Orient Express there.

Room 101, exhibiting the traces of Mustafa Kemal Atatürk, preserving the splendour of that period with its grandeur and opening its gates to travel in time; can be visited by everyone between 10.00-11.00 and 15.00-16.00 every day at Pera Palace Hotel.

The hotel also has an amazing tea room. And the KUBBELI LOUNGE with the incredible domes features in the Michelin Guide.
